There isn’t a day that goes by that I don’t miss my mom. I wish she
could have been there when my girls got married, when my
grandchildren were born… to continue to be that  part of my  life
that only she could be…my mom …my very dear friend. When she
died in 1998 I felt as though I had been robbed. After all, women in
our family don’t die at the age of 69 ….and they don’t die of  ovarian
cancer.  
Suddenly my medical history had changed not only for me but for my
girls as well. It included cancer. How could this disease take her from
us without warning? Ovarian cancer has been called the “silent
killer”. It certainly was for my mom. The symptoms of ovarian cancer
are easily dismissed…until they become severe. Such was the case
for my mom. Please take time to check out the “Ovarian Cancer
National Alliance” website and send the link to all the women  in your
life. It may save the life of someone very dear to you.
